The morning was a blur in Peter’s mind, they had done so much to prepare for the monsters. Raul had given him a spear, or rather a sharpened stick. The slit through which you could enter the cave was even more hidden now, being covered by some ivy they found.
There was now a pit where they could there fresh water, digging the pit alone took three hours, but it was totally worth it.
Peters hand shook, the time was almost there. The sun was at around the same position as it was when the blue box popped up. He sat next to Raul talking about strategy.
“So we’ll try to lure the monsters to the cave entrance, where we’ll go inside the cave, and then kill them. Just stab them while they go inside, it’ll work.”
“Okay, okay. Can we maybe capture one alive though?”
“Why, we should just kill all of those monsters.”
Spit flew out of Raul’s mouth, as if the monsters had slaughtered his entire family, hatred was apparent on his face.
“Because I want to feed one this plant.”
It was an excellent chance for Peter to find out what the green plant did, he already felt pity for the poor monster. He had to steel himself though, just like Raul. Either they died or he did, and a choice like that was easily made.
Protection has dropped!
Monsters are encouraged to hunt humans.
They were coming, Peter could almost smell the tension in the air. He heard howls through the forest, must have been wolves or something.
“Fuck, wolves are coming too. Hope they don’t catch our scent.”
Peter hoped that too as he had prior experience. These wolves were scary, with those red eyes they had a crazed look. Shivering, Peter likened the color to blood. Blood red eyes, wolves only hunting for blood and raw human meat.

Quickly he activated meditation, because scary thoughts had no place in his mind. The howls got closer and closer. Then Raul gave the signal to enter the cave.
The wolves had arrived just after they had entered the cave. Peter couldn’t really see what they were doing, but they must have been searching. Searching for their scent, smelling the air with their scary noses. They would be unpleasantly surprised because after they tried entering the cave, if they even could, they would meet their end by their spears.
Peter wanted to get stronger and their essence would help him reach his goal. He heard scratching at the entrance and Raul went to the front of the cave to look if they came. They couldn’t enter, a fact for which Peter was grateful, even though he wanted their essence.
He and Raul sat in silence for about an hour, but then the scratching suddenly stopped. Had the wolves given up?
They heard some scurrying and then suddenly a green head popped out of the entrance. It was a goblin! He let out a primal roar and ran towards the green bugger, pointing his spear at its stomach. Raul ran towards it as well and soon the entrance was blocked by a dead goblin. Their spears had easily made the goblin as dead as dead could be. Peter could almost feel the essence flowing into him.
As they began dragging the body deeper into the cave, in an effort to free the entrance, the next goblin already popped in. Like a well-oiled machine two sticks stabbed him. Peter had to much adrenaline in him to think about ethics and the easy with which he slaughtered these poor creatures.
They repeated this process for what seemed like an eternity, and when the cave was almost filled to the brim the goblins stopped coming. The scratching had also stopped, either the wolves had lost interested or they were waiting to ambush them as soon as the stepped out of the cave.

A blue box popped up however, freeing him of his doubts.
You have survived your first wave of monsters! Monsters have temporarily leaved.
195 Essence gained.
You leveled up! 1 attribute point available.
“It seems were safe now. Lets quickly get these corpses out of the cave before it begins to stink.”
Raul had just said it and then he realized how much blood there was. It smelled like poop too, but even worse. Some stomachs and intestines must have been cut open. Dragging bodies out of a very small entrances was a hellish chore, Peter now knew that. He felt sick, so much lost life. All at the cost of making him a bit quicker, a bit faster. He would think about how to use his attribute point later, after the cave was clean, and after he had gotten a good nights sleep. Because by God, he needed the rest.
